We are pleased to announce availability of our tools for simplified issue reporting.
LogDigger browser extensions, supported by the LogDigger Server, allow you to report bugs to your favorite bug tracker much faster and with much more details than ever before. The LogDigger Server 1.0 supports JIRA, Bugzilla, Mantis and Redmine issue tracking software, with more [...]

About

We are a micro-ISV, founded around a common passion – to improve the process of issue reporting, so that even occasional testers (such as customers and managers) can easily provide developers with the sort of input that we, personally, always wanted to have. We wish to eliminate boring manual tasks from the process, so that developers and testers can enjoy what they do a lot more.
